How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Aurora District?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Aurora District Studio Apartments | $1,077 | $984 | $1,229 |
| Aurora District 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,423 | $917 | $2,991 |
| Aurora District 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,810 | $1,093 | $3,612 |
| Aurora District 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,484 | $1,892 | $3,772 |
| Aurora District 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,150 | $2,032 | $4,142 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Aurora District
How much are Studio apartments in Aurora District?
There are currently 19 Studio Apartments in Aurora District with rent ranges from $984 to $1,229 with an average price of $1,077.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Aurora District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Aurora District ranges from $917 to $2,991 with an average monthly rent of $1,423.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Aurora District c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Aurora District range from $1,093 to $3,612.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,810.
How expensive are Aurora District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 28 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Aurora District on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,892 to $3,772 - averaging $2,484 for the location.
